MEMO — Kettling Depot Receiving

Uniform sets for the new Kettling depot arrive Wednesday via Ashgrove courier: 40 boxes, sorted by size, manifest attached to box one. Check the count at the dock before signing; shortages go straight to stores, not the courier. The hand-over instruction the courier will follow is set out below.

drop instructions, tafof-baguf: the holmir gilox courier leaves the sormir ulaok holdor ledger at gate 5596 under passcode 257343

## Releases

Tallyport payment-service releases are gated on the integration suite, which is flaky around the ledger-reconciliation tests. Reruns are permitted twice before a release is blocked. Flaky failures are logged to the Quorumline tracker for audit. All release artifacts are signed prior to publication; reviewers can verify signatures using the key that follows.

signing key of bagap-yawep = bky13_TbfT6ZMUoGJo2

// MAX_STABLE_SORT_ROWS
//
// The Ledgerline report builder switches from the stable merge sort to
// the faster in-place sort above this row count. The in-place path is
// NOT stable: rows with equal keys may reorder between runs, which
// breaks snapshot diffs for the Harwick dashboards. If customers report
// shifting row order, check whether their report exceeds this limit.
// The regression that set this value is tied to the trace token below.

pipeline stamp: htk9_ce63042d9

Handover: Splitwave assignment service — from Dariya to Mikkel. Heads up for the sync: the bucket-hashing fix is live, so variant drift on the Pinecrest experiment should stop. Still pending: the stale-config alert keeps firing on weekends; snooze rule is half-written in my branch. If the admin console locks you out mid-migration, you'll need the recovery passphrase, which is:

vault phrase of hawif-bahof = novvan-belius-istael-fenvan-holdor-druox-eliath